Spencer Carpenter is the founder of Outlier Audio, a podcast booking agency. Spencer has booked over 1,500 interviews that have garnered millions of downloads for talented Celebrities, Entrepreneurs, Pro Athletes, Authors, Investors, and Top Keynote Speakers. Questions with a Podcast Booking Agent is designed to be quick and actionable advice where Spencer answers common questions on how to get booked on podcasts, dos and don'ts, and industry trends.
